Wear protective clothing and glasses or goggles to prevent eye contact Always read the health and safety advice on labels Avoid solvents on your skin. Solvent wiping will degrease your skin and can lead to dermatitis. Always work in ventilated areas and allow plenty of airflow. Wear a suitable respirator if in doubt Always wet-sand anti-foul as the dust is toxic Do not eat or smoke when handling paint Keep cans sealed and dispose of waste paint at a re-cycle centre
